FVALUE CALCULATION
Reset
In order to reset the totalized value, ‘Trigger input’ and/or ‘Analog input’ can be specified. Touch the ‘None’ key in Page
3/7 for ‘Trigger,’ the one in Page 4/7 for ‘Analog input’ conditions. If you leave the setting to ‘None,’ the data is reset
only when ‘Start’ key is touched.
For details of the trigger input selections, please refer to ‘Peak Hold’ function.
For the analog input resetting, choose one of the following conditions:
None
No resetting by analog input. Reset only when ‘Start’ key is touched.
Value < Limit
Reset when the measured value is lower than the limit value.
Value ≤ Limit
Reset when the measured value is equal to or lower than the limit value.
Limit / Deadband
Specify Limit value used to reset the function result.
Deadband is used to prevent repeating of F value cal-
culation execution and resetting when the measured
value stays unstable close to the limit value.
A positive deadband is used to reset at ‘Limit – Dead-
band,’ while a negative deadband is used to reset at
‘Limit + Deadband.’
By choosing an wide deadband, you can set different
values for set and reset conditions.

Caution !
100 msec. storing interval is not usable with F value calculation.
Be careful to choose a pen of Not Itself. For example, you cannot choose Function Pen 1 or the X2
in an equation for Function Pen 1.
‘e’ can be used to input an exponential value such as ‘1e9.’ Entering ‘e’ in any other way (e.g. ‘1ee’)
will not be recognized as a numeral.
